Hair transplant surgery is a popular solution for those suffering from hair loss. It involves taking hair follicles from a donor area, typically the back or sides of the head, and transplanting them to the balding areas. The amount of hair required for a successful transplant varies from person to person.
For some individuals, 100 grams of hair may be sufficient to achieve their desired results. However, this amount may not be enough for others, especially those with extensive hair loss or those seeking a more significant transformation. The surgeon will evaluate the patient’s hair density, the area to be treated, and the patient’s expectations to determine the appropriate amount of hair needed.
Several factors can influence the amount of hair required for a transplant. These include:
1. Hair loss pattern: Individuals with a receding hairline or a horseshoe pattern may require less hair than those with a more widespread balding pattern.
2. Hair density: Thicker hair can cover more area than finer hair, potentially reducing the amount needed for a transplant.
3. Desired outcome: Some patients may be satisfied with a subtle change, while others may seek a more dramatic transformation.
4. Surgeon expertise: An experienced surgeon can maximize the results from a limited amount of hair, ensuring that the transplant looks natural and aesthetically pleasing.
It’s essential for patients to have realistic expectations and communicate openly with their surgeon regarding their goals. In some cases, a single procedure may be sufficient to achieve the desired outcome, while others may require multiple sessions to achieve the best results.
